Q: Is 657,723,042 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 657,723,042 is a composite number.

Why is 657,723,042 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 657,723,042 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 23 46 69 83 138 166 207 249 414 498 747 1,494 1,909 3,818 5,727 11,454 17,181 19,141 34,362 38,282 57,423 114,846 172,269 344,538 440,243 880,486 1,320,729 1,588,703 2,641,458 3,177,406 3,962,187 4,766,109 7,924,374 9,532,218 14,298,327 28,596,654 36,540,169 73,080,338 109,620,507 219,241,014 328,861,521 and 657,723,042, with no remainder.

Since 657,723,042 cannot be divided by just 1 and 657,723,042, it is a composite number.
